Usage Scenarios:
The BENTLY Nevada is ideal for a multitude of industrial applications, including power generation, oil and gas, and manufacturing. Whether you're monitoring turbines, compressors, or pumps, this model provides the insights needed to predict failures before they occur. Its ability to integrate with existing systems means it can be deployed in both new and retrofitted installations. For instance, in a power plant, the BENTLY Nevada can continuously monitor turbine vibrations, alerting operators to any irregularities that could indicate potential failures. In manufacturing, it helps optimize machine performance, reducing downtime and maintenance costs.
